The 14th Seiser Alm Half Marathon returns on 4 July 2027, reaffirming its place among the most scenic mountain half marathons in the Dolomites. Set on Seiser Alm (Alpe di Siusi), Europe's largest high-altitude alpine meadow, this spectacular running event takes place in the heart of the UNESCO World Heritage Dolomites, offering an unforgettable experience for runners surrounded by breathtaking alpine scenery.
The 21 km course, featuring 600 metres of elevation gain, winds through alpine meadows, mountain huts and panoramic trails, making it the perfect race for enthusiasts of mountain running, trail running and high-altitude races. The race starts and finishes in Compatsch, with the official start at 9:00 a.m.
The Seiser Alm Half Marathon is one of South Tyrol's premier running events, attracting athletes and recreational runners from around the world who want to experience running in one of the most spectacular alpine landscapes in Europe.
